New Solutions of VoIP on Multi-hop Wireless Network
The effective provision of real-time, packet-based voice conversations over multi-hop wireless networks faces several stringent constraints not found in conventional packet-based networks. The wireless links in an ad hoc network are highly error prone and may go down frequently because of node mobility, interference, channel fading, and the lack of infrastructure, it is very difficult and challenging to implement voice transmission over multi-hop wireless networks. In this research, to maximize the performance of multi-hop wireless networks during voice transmission we choose some parameters and methodological approaches e.g. Since voice applications consume more energy than typical applications, we designed the ad hoc and adaptive control model to simulate our scheme.
